Franklin, NC - James (J. B.) Bronlowe Passmore, age 51, of Pannell Lane, Franklin, NC, passed away Thursday, June 19, 2008 at his residence. He was a native of Macon County, the son of James C. and Betty Cowart Passmore of Franklin, NC.

He had worked as a sales and service representative for Terminix. He was a Country Musician and formed the J. B. Passmore Band. He was a member of Cartoogechaye Church of God.

In addition to his parents, he is survived by his wife of ten years, Diane Spencer Passmore; one daughter, Tomeka Ammons and her husband, Greg of Franklin; two sons, Jamie Passmore and his wife Christy and Jason Passmore and his wife Eva all of Franklin, NC; two step-daughters, Summer Passmore and her husband Kevin of Franklin, NC and Kelly Scoggins of Orlando, FL; two brothers, Tony Passmore and his wife Angie of Sylva, NC and Taburn Passmore of Atlanta, GA; eighteen grandchildren also survive.

Funeral services will be held Monday, June 23rd at 11:00am at Cartoogechaye Church of God, with Rev. Phillip Cochran officiating. Burial will be at Mt. Zion Cemetery. Pallbearers will be Mike Wooten, Jerry Lowery, David McFalls, Kyle Edwards, Tracy Kilpatrick and Bobby Sherman.

The family will receive friends from 6:00 to 8:00pm Sunday evening at Bryant-Grant Funeral Home. After the service, the family will meet at the home of Tomeka Ammons on Sawdust Trail, Franklin, NC. Memorials may be made to Cartoogechaye Church of God, 73 Johnson Road, Franklin, NC 28734.

Bryant-Grant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.
